Overview
What this settlement is about
A court-approved settlement provides compensation to eligible former students of two Nova Scotia schools for Deaf students, including systemic-harms payments and an assessment process for certain physical or sexual abuse claims.
Eligibility summary
Who may be eligible
Former students of the Halifax School for the Deaf or the Interprovincial School for the Education of the Deaf in Amherst who attended between 1913 and 1995 as a residential student, day student, or vocational student who was first a residential or day student may qualify. Estates of class members who died on or after January 31, 2019 may qualify for some compensation; students who attended only the Amherst vocational program do not qualify.
